Sansa Clip+ not organizing to tags

I am having a problem to organize the files on my Sansa Clip+ player.
I used Puddletag to set the tags on the mp3 files. There are 24 files. I set the album to acts and the genre to christian rock. I also set the track numbers in order that I want to play. When I access the files in the player with music/albums/acts I only have 12 or the 24 songs show up. When I access through music/genres/christian Rock I only get 8 that show up.

Is this a bug with the player; is there a way to fix this?
